The 1881 Census reveals a detailed snapshot of households in England, Wales and Scotland. The census was taken on April 3rd and the total population was recorded as 29,707,207.
In the 1881 Census, the household of Richard Turner, born in 1822 in Wiltshire, consisted of 7 members. Richard was the head of the household, married to Rebecca Turner, born in 1827 in Heytesbury, Wiltshire, England. They had 5 children; James (born 1858 in Heytesbury, Wiltshire, England), Eliza (born 1860 in Heytesbury, Wiltshire, England), Edward (born 1865 in Heytesbury, Wiltshire, England), Isaac (born 1866 in Heytesbury, Wiltshire, England) and Emily (born 1869 in Heytesbury, Wiltshire, England).
